小程序wafer2-nodejs 本地服务器运行Error: ERR_INIT_SDK_LOST_CONFIG

 

本地开发,npm run dev 报错:

    if ([rootPathname, useQcloudLogin, cos, serverHost, tunnelServerUrl, tunnelS
ignatureKey, qcloudAppId, qcloudSecretId, qcloudSecretKey, wxMessageToken].some(
v => v === undefined)) throw new Error(ERRORS.ERR_INIT_SDK_LOST_CONFIG)


                       ^

Error: ERR_INIT_SDK_LOST_CONFIG
    at init (D:\wafer2_1\server\node_modules\wafer-node-sdk\index.js:48
:190)
  
[nodemon] app crashed - waiting for file changes before starting...

原因是server/config.js的配置变量名搞错了

serverHost: 'localhost',
    tunnelServerUrl: '',
    tunnelSignatureKey: '',
    qcloudAppId:'xxxxxx',
    qcloudSecretId:'xxxx',
    qcloudSecretKey:'wxxx',
    networkTimeout:30000,

逐一对比就可以了

参考链接,另外有数据库异常配置,可以参考接通本地开发环境
作者:番茄土豆222
链接:https://www.jianshu.com/p/ffa90a0e9770

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值